How To Get Smoke Smell Out Of House

Are you having a hard time getting the smoke smell out of your house? If so, you’re not alone. Smoke can linger in a home long after the fire is put out. Smoke odor is one of the most difficult smells to remove from a house.

There are many ways to get the smoke smell out of your house. If the smell is only in a small area, you can try using a deodorizer or air freshener. If the smell is more widespread, you may need to use a stronger method.

One of the best ways to remove smoke odor from your house is to use an ozone generator. Ozone generators create ozone, which is a powerful oxidizing agent. When ozone comes in contact with smoke, it breaks down the smoke molecules and eliminates the odor.

How To Get Rid Of Smoke

Here are some tips on how to get the smoke smell out of your house:

1. Open up all the windows and doors to air out the house. This will allow fresh air to circulate through your house and will help to get rid of the smoke smell. You can also use a fan to help circulate the air in your house.

2. Clean all surfaces with a solution of vinegar and water. This will help to remove the smoke residue from surfaces in your house. Mix one cup of vinegar with two cups of water and pour it into a spray bottle. Spray the mixture onto the affected areas and let it sit for about 15 minutes. Then, wipe the area clean with a towel.

3. Place bowls of vinegar around the house. Vinegar is a natural odor absorber. By placing bowls of vinegar around your house, you will help to absorb the smoke smell from the air.

4. Purchase an air purifier. An air purifier will help to remove the smoke smell from the air in your house.

5. Burn candles or incense. Candles and incense can help to mask the smoke smell in your house.

6. Use baking soda. Baking soda is a natural odor absorber. By sprinkling baking soda around your house, you will help to absorb the smoke smell. Or if it is a small surface, you can just sprinkle baking soda over the affected areas and let it sit for about 15 minutes. Then, wipe the area clean with a towel.

7. Hire a professional cleaning company. A professional cleaning company will have the knowledge and equipment to properly clean your house and remove the smoke smell from it.

Smoke Remediation

Smoke remediation is the process of removing smoke odor from a house. There are many different ways to do this, but the most common method is to use an ozone machine.

An ozone machine creates ozone, which is a gas that reacts with smoke molecules and breaks them down. This process effectively removes the smoke smell from your house.

Ozone machines can be rented or purchased for home use. If you hire a professional company to do the work, they will bring their own ozone machine. The cost of hiring a professional company to remove smoke odor from your house will vary depending on the size of your house and the severity of the smoke damage.

Smoke Remediation Process

The process of smoke remediation involves:

1. Inspect the house to assess the extent of the smoke damage.

2. Using an ozone machine to break down the smoke molecules and remove the smoke smell.

3. Cleaning all surfaces in the house to remove any smoke residue.

4. Ventilating the house to get rid of any lingering smoke odor.

5. Replacing any absorbent materials that have been damaged by smoke, such as carpets and drywall.

How To Get Fire Smoke Smell Out Of Couch?

If your couch has been damaged by fire smoke, you will need to take special care to clean it and remove the smoke smell.

  • Start by vacuuming the couch with a powerful vacuum cleaner. Be sure to get into all the nooks and crannies, as smoke residue can build up in these areas.
  • Use a stiff brush to scrub the couch fabric. This will help to loosen any lingering smoke residue.
  • Use an upholstery cleaner or a solution of vinegar and water to clean the couch fabric. Be sure to follow the manufacturer’s instructions carefully.
  • Once you have cleaned the couch fabric, you can use a deodorizer or scent diffuser to help mask the smoke smell.

How To Get Smoke Smell Out Of House After Microwave Fire?

If you have had a fire in your microwave, it is important to clean it properly and remove the smoke smell.

  • Start by unplugging the microwave and removing any food or debris from it.
  • Use a stiff brush to scrub the inside of the microwave, being sure to get into all the nooks and crannies.
  • Use a solution of vinegar and water to clean the inside of the microwave. Be sure to follow the manufacturer’s instructions carefully.
  • Once you have cleaned the inside of the microwave, you can use a deodorizer or scent diffuser to help mask the smoke smell. You can also try placing a bowl of baking soda inside the microwave to absorb any lingering smoke odor.
